Description
Example of Victorian English fairground carving by master carver Charles Spooner of Burton-on-Trent is this spandrel-shaped show-front board with a carved Dragon's head and other fragments of Spooner's carving which came from a late 19th century fairground show.
The board is a remnant from a collection of fairground scenery bought in 1997 at the closure of the Wookey Hole Fairground Collection in Somerset, England.
In reasonable condition with the original gilding on a restored & repainted backing board
Made in Burton-on-Trent, England by the company of George Orton Sons & Spooner.
